  6. TheScionicMan's Avatar
    When you compose a new email message from the All Accounts mailbox, it will use your default email address as bash_man pointed out. If you are in one of the particular account mailboxes instead of All, it will use that account for a new message. With a new email, you can easily pull down the From: menu and select which address you want it to be sent from. When replying to an email, it will use the account that it was received from and doesn't have the pulldown option to change accounts.
